Day 21 中场休息,来做点酷东西(重构 class)

今天做了

  1. 重构程序码,写了一个基本的 component class 让 ProjectInput class 和 ProjectList class 可以继承。

https://ithelp.ithome.com.tw/upload/images/20211006/20131989aFNrmKbILw.png
https://ithelp.ithome.com.tw/upload/images/20211006/20131989fKjUgrg2x9.png
https://ithelp.ithome.com.tw/upload/images/20211006/20131989N85Yn04xG9.png

  1. 新增 State class,如果之後专案要扩充,不只有 Project 的状态要管理时,就也能再次继承该 class。

https://ithelp.ithome.com.tw/upload/images/20211006/20131989dMRcA7rMDv.png

总之,就是把共用的地方抽取出来,不要再重写,做可以重复使用的 class,可以让程序码更好维护以及更好阅读哦!

写到後期发现每天发文真的是一件很困难的事啊阿阿,好佩服其他的参赛者,今天真的写很少,明天会尽力把这个专案结束掉 QQ。


<<:  Day24 - 权限控制

>>:  [Q&A] 06 风险评监报告生出来前的修修改改

SQL Server 资料库设定标准化 - 心得分享

DBA Bootcamp 这里所讲的设定是指安装SQL资料库时的设定。如果你只需要管理三到五个资料库...

Day 27 - ROS 树莓派光达履带小车实作 (1)

终於进入小车实作啦~~~~上个连假笔者本来就要来写的,结果拖到这个连假才有空来玩车车XD 首先介绍笔...

Wrapping up

终於来到最後一篇了!不经不觉已经写了三十篇文章。我们由 Ktor client 接驳 API 一直讲...

Day 03 环境建立

环境设定 当我们在做开发时,首先要做的,就是准备好开发环境, 不然所有的开发都会无法进行, 所以首先...

[Day 24] IIOT资讯安全规划

调查 查其他同业是否有案例 台积电产线中毒大当机,52亿元资安震撼教育 工业电脑大厂研华证实部分服务...